partial set list...there were a few songs i didn't know. Great concert. sounded great. His drummer is the best musician in the band.
Drive my Car Jet <new song> <new song> Got to get you into my life Let me roll it <new song> long and winding road my love blackbird Here today Dance tonight Callico skies ( lyrics were 'for the rest of my life') <new song> Eleanor Rigby <new song> Band on the run Back in the USSR I'm down Something I've got a feeling Paperback writer A day in the life<Give peace a chance Live and let die Hey Jude
Encore Daytripper Lady Madonna Saw her standing there Yesterday Helter Skelter Get Back Sgt. Pepper<The End
